The specs of Samsung's upcoming entry-level and mid-range devices, the Galaxy A11 and Galaxy A41, have surfaced online. According to a post from Android Headlines, the entry-level Samsung Galaxy A11 will sport a 6.2-inch HD+ display powered by an Exynos 7 octa-core processor paired with 3GB of RAM. As for the mid-range Galaxy A41, Steve McFly (or @OnLeaks on Twitter) with Pricebaba has posted renders and key specs of the device. According to the post, the Galaxy A41 will come with a 6 to 6.1-inch display powered by a MediaTek Helio P65 processor paired with 4GB of RAM and 64GB to 128GB of storage. Unlike the Galaxy A11, the Galaxy A41 employs Samsung's Infinity-U design to house the 25MP front camera. Lastly, the Galaxy A41 is said to come with a 3,500mAh battery, which is far less than the A11's 5,000mAh battery. Samsung has launched the Galaxy Z TriFold for pre-order in China, priced at 19,999 Yuan (~$2,830), putting it in direct competition with Huawei’s Mate XTs in the growing tri-fold smartphone market. The device runs One UI 8 based on Android 16, supports Galaxy AI features, and introduces standalone Samsung DeX for desktop-style productivity.
